    Greater Solar System (Abreviated as GSS) is a fictional arrangement of planets and stellar objects that can be used for ideology/user/geopolitical mapping. It contains one intermediate-mass black hole, 8 stars, 1 brown dwarf, two rogue planets, ~75 planets, and dozens of moons. Eleven of these planets are in the habitable zones of stars, possessing the necessary ingredients and qualities for human habitability.

    Habitable Planets

    GSS Earth

    You probably know what to expect with this one. The planet Earth is a habitable planet orbiting the star Sol. It takes 365 days to orbit Sol and rotates on its axis once every 23.9 hours. It weighs 5.97E+24 kg and has a diameter of 12742 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 99.1 kPa. It has one moon, Luna, that orbits Earth once every ~27 days. It is tidally locked; the inhabitants only see one side of Luna. Surface gravity is 9.81 meters per second per second. It has existed in all versions of the Greater Solar System, including the prototypes; it has orbited Sol in all of them.

    GSS Aelivyt

    The planet Aelivyt is a habitable planet orbiting the star M3B7. It takes 344 days to orbit M3B7 and rotates on its axis once every 22.9 hours. It weighs 5.95E+24 kg and has a diameter of 12602 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 109 kPa. It has one moon, Zhoplikin, that orbits Aelivyt once every ~9.93 days. It is not tidally locked. Surface gravity is 9.99 meters per second squared. It has existed in the 3rd, 4th, and 5th (most recent) versions of the GSS, orbiting M3B7 in all of them.

    GSS Tercuptas

    The planet Tercuptas is a habitable planet orbiting the star Denmit. It takes 1.60 years to orbit Denmit and rotates on its axis once every 18.6 hours. It is one of the lighter habitable planets, weighing 5.61E+24 kg and having a diameter of 12822 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 112 kPa. It has two moons, Ipogolit and Hydrit, orbiting the planet once every 4.42 days and 15.7 days respectively. The moons are not tidally locked. Surface gravity is 9.12 meters per second squared. It has existed from the 2nd to the most recent versions of GSS, orbiting Erytinser in the 2nd/3rd and orbiting Denmit in the 4th/5th/6th.

    GSS Idell

    The planet Idell is a habitable planet orbiting the star Denmit (like Tercuptas). It takes 359 days to orbit Denmit and rotates on its axis once every 1.09 days. It is the largest habitable planet, weighing 8.48E+24 kg and having a diameter of 14526 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 82.3 kPa. It has two moons, Der-Tolip and Idellia, orbiting the planet once every 6.51 days and 15.1 days respectively. Der-Tolip is tidally locked while Idellia isn't. Surface gravity is 10.7 meters per second squared. It has existed from the 2nd to the most recent versions of GSS, orbiting Erytinser in the 2nd/3rd and orbiting Denmit in the 4th/5th/6th.

    GSS Mnustun

    The planet Mnus Tun is a habitable planet orbiting the star Denmit (like Tercuptas & Idell). It takes 1.27 years to orbit Denmit and rotates on its axis once every 1.10 days. It weighs 6.15E+24 kg and has a diameter of 13318 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 106 kPa. It has one moon, Tunyet. It is not tidally locked and orbits Mnus Tun once every 3.26 days. Surface gravity is 9.26 meters per second squared. It has existed from the 2nd to the most recent versions of GSS, orbiting Erytinser in the 2nd/3rd and orbiting Denmit in the 4th/5th/6th.

    GSS Ghoribel

    The planet Ghoribel is a habitable planet orbiting the star Curio. It takes 203 days to orbit Curio and rotates on its axis once every 22.2 hours. It weighs in at 5.33E+24 kg and has a diameter of 12416 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 119 kPa. It has one moon (Ghorite) that is not tidally locked and orbits once every 1.38 days. Surface gravity is 9.23 meters per second squared. It has existed from the 3rd to the most recent version of GSS, orbiting Dirilus in the 3rd and orbiting Curio in the 4th/5th/6th.

    GSS Monoterrapes

    The planet Monoterrapes is a habitable planet orbiting the star Belyreschevo. It takes 1.33 years to orbit Belyreschevo and 1.49 days to rotate on its own axis. It weighs in at 6.27E+24 kg and has a diameter of 12796 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 106 kPa. It has one moon (Lunarov) that orbits Monoterrapes every 21.5 days. Surface gravity is 10.2 meters per second squared. It has always orbited Belyreschevo, and the planet has only existed in the fifth and sixth versions.

    GSS Shevloveriy

    The planet Shevloveriy is a habitable planet that orbits Belyreschevo. It takes 1.57 years to revolve about Belyreschevo and 20.8 hours about its own axis. It weighs in at 6.15E+24 kg and has a diameter of 12502 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 92.9 kPa. It has two moons (Relezovir and Belofront) that orbit every 3.13 days and 30.4 days respectively. Surface gravity is 10.5 meters per second squared. It has always orbited Belyreschevo, and the planet has only existed in the fifth and sixth versions.

    GSS Neokursito

    The planet Neokursito is a habitable planet that orbits Belyreschevo. It takes 1.87 years to orbit around Belyreschevo as well as 1.07 days to revolve. Its mass is 7.91E+24 kg while its diameter is 13804 km. Atmospheric pressure is 90.5 kPa. It has two moons (Mefitis and Leveroskyy) that orbit the planet every 2.83 days and 11.9 days respectively. Surface gravity is 11.1 meters per second squared. It has always orbited Belyreschevo, and the planet has only existed in the fifth and sixth versions.

    GSS Nelaporitos

    Out of all of the Belyreschevo habitable planets, Nelaporitos is the farthest out. With an orbital period of 2.18 years and a rotation period of 1.22 days, this planet holds the title for the longest orbital period of a habitable world in GSS. It weighs 5.33E+24 kg and is 12376 kilometers in diameter. It is also covered in a dense sheath of atmosphere, clocking in at 185 kilopascals of surface pressure. It also has a gravity of 9.28 meters per second squared. It has always orbited Belyreschevo, and the planet has only existed in the 5th/6th versions.

    GSS Coruscant

    If you're an avid Star Wars fan, you should probably know what to expect here. This planet is noticeably different from the other habitable planets. Coruscant (known as Coruscant II) is a semi-habitable planet that orbits its star Coruscant (Coruscant Prime or Coruscant I) every Earth year. Its rotational period is also the same as that of Earth. It weighs 1.64E+25 kg and is 17698 kilometers in diameter. Its atmosphere is also very dense, clocking it at 760 kPa, and people are encouraged to live at higher elevations, the highest barometric pressure for a habitable planet. Surface gravity on the planet is 14.0 meters per second squared. This planet has existed in only the sixth and latest rendition of GSS.

    Methane Planets

    GSS M3B70P8

    The planet M3B70P8 is an icy, methane-ocean planet orbiting the star M3B7. It takes 116 years to orbit M3B7 and 2.10 years to rotate on its own axis once (quite a lengthy day and night if you ask me). It weighs in at 6.79E+25 kg and has a diameter of 22444 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ure on the planet is 3.00 MPa as this planet is in an oppressive Venus-like state. The planet has three moons (M3B8, Microlevo, and Desckor), orbiting M3B70P8 every 12.8 days, 27.9 days, and 273 days respectively. Surface gravity is 36.0 meters per second squared. It has only existed in the 5th/6th versions of GSS.

    GSS Titan

    The planet Titan is more accurately considered a moon than a planet. It takes 15.5 days to orbit Saturn (it is also tidally locked to Saturn), which in itself takes 29.2 years to orbit Sol. It weighs in at 1.35E+23 kg and has a diameter of 5150 km. Atmospheric pressure is 95.9 kPa. It, as a moon that is close to its host, does not have any sub-moons of its own. Surface gravity is 1.35 meters per second squared. It has existed in every rendition of GSS.

    GSS Niminthes

    The planet Niminthes is a methane-ocean planet orbiting the star Denmit. It takes 152 years to orbit Denmit and rotates on its own axis every 1.55 days. It weighs in at 9.52E+24 kg and has a diameter of 17360 kilometers. Atmospheric pressure is 100 kPa. It has two moons (Niminthes b and c), both being tidally locked. Niminthes b orbits every 3.10 days while c orbits every 11.8 days. Surface gravity is 8.44 meters per second squared. It existed in the 3rd version as a liquid water planet, in the 4th and 5th versions as an arid ice planet, and in the 6th as a liquid methane planet.
